In this paper, we analyzed the role of the explanations in a mathematics course on the first semester of engineering, when the variation notion is being used by the professor and at the time of which the students take part with it. In particular, we are focus in the notion of function and derivative that are seen as models for the study of variation.
We focused our attention in the role of the speech in the mathematics class when concepts and processes related to the variation notion are taught, because we considered that the speech constitutes the space where meanings are constructed, negotiated and interpreted.. The register and the transcriptions of the course are analyzed considering a particular model of qualitative research.
